This is the title screen for The Mystical Journey. This screen will come up as soon as the program is first run. The background image is from a fight scene that takes place in a forest.
This is the main map screen for The Mystical Journey. Every level in the game can be accessed from this map. When it's finished, TMJ should have around 60 levels.
This is the first village, Roama, in The Mystical Journey. The opening cinema will introduce the player to a deadly threat here in a cave.
This cave exists to the south-west of Roama. After learning of the monster in Roama Cave, you must journey to Tanden, through this cave, Tanden Cave, to get an elixir to save an old man.
This is Roama Castle, home of the king who rules over Roama and Roama Cave. Later in the game, you can go here to meet a new character who will join your party.
This is an example of the magic, inferno, as used during combat. It fades the screen to red then ripples it.
This shows how combat will look when the enemy and the player are waiting for their turns to make a move.
This shows the menu system in the fight scenes of TMJ. The left menu allows the player to choose what kind of action to take; the right menu breaks down the options further.
This shows how hits are displayed after attacking an enemy. This background is the same one seen on the title screen.
This background would be in a fight scene that takes place where a river passes through mountains.
This background would be in a fight scene where a bridge crosses over a river.
This is the stat screen that is accessed by pressing [ESC] while on the map screen.  From here, the colors can be configured, the game can be saved, a game can be loaded, or the player can quit TMJ (but why would one want to do that?).
